Originally Said By: Lon Winters
  1. Make sure you're capturing the User Level into a Session variable using the login user wizard in SA.  



How do you set up SA to capture the User Level and change it accordingly? I used the Free eCommerce MySQL database to have some groundwork and I want 3 levels. I went through the wizard already and had it create the login, logout, registration, etc So how do I correctly add to the database:

0 - Guest, not logged in
1 - Member, Logged in but no access to premium area
2 - Customer, Logged in and granted access to premium area


Edit: I think this answers most of my question.. securityassist_user_level_auth_sr.pdf but do I need anything more specific in the db, such as collation, null, or default values?
